Xojo Conferences
XDCMay2019MiamiUSA

thread legt interace lahm (Real Studio network user group Deutschland Mailinglist archive)

Back to the thread list
Previous thread: Listboxspalte nach Zahlen sortieren
Next thread: Sourcecode zum Layouten gesucht


Probleme mit String Bearbeitung   -   Markus Schnell
  thread legt interace lahm   -   Yves Seiler
   Re: thread legt interace lahm   -   Andy Fuchs
   Re: thread legt interace lahm   -   Yves Seiler
   Re: thread legt interace lahm   -   Yves Seiler
    Re: thread legt interace lahm   -   Andy Fuchs

thread legt interace lahm
Date: 08.08.05 10:26 (Mon, 8 Aug 2005 11:26:10 +0200)
From: Yves Seiler
hallo
hab mir vorhin einen thread gebastelt, der ein bild öffnet, es
verkleinert und wieder abspeichert.
dieser legt jedoch das ganze interface lahm... ich habe schon
versucht, die priorität herunterzunehmen,
das ändert jedoch nichts.

wie kann ich machen, dass das interface benutzbar bleibt (es soll
zumindest angezeigt werden, wie weit
der thread fortgeschritten ist). Kann ich mit stacksize was machen?

gruss
yves

Re: thread legt interace lahm
Date: 08.08.05 10:49 (Mon, 08 Aug 2005 11:49:37 +0200)
From: Andy Fuchs
Legt der Thread das Interface lahm, oder die Skalierungsfunktion?

Falls letzteres, mußt Du diese in den Thread portieren...

Ansonsten: Code zeigen

-

Re: thread legt interace lahm
Date: 08.08.05 11:17 (Mon, 8 Aug 2005 12:17:15 +0200)
From: Yves Seiler
hi christian
das wusste ich nicht, du meinst also, die funktionen extern in einer
methode anlegen und dann via thread aufrufen?
werde ich mal versuchen:)

gruss
yves

On Aug 8, 2005, at 12:07 PM, Christian Schmitz wrote:

> Yves Seiler <<email address removed>> wrote:
>
>> hallo
>> hab mir vorhin einen thread gebastelt, der ein bild öffnet, es
>> verkleinert und wieder abspeichert.
>>
> Das Öffnen, das Skalieren und das Abspeichern düften jeweils nicht
> gethreaded sein.
>
> Allerdings hab ich in meinem Plugin die Möglichkeit geschaffen JPEGs
> zeilenweise zu laden (speichern) um das zu threaden.
>
> Mfg
> Christian
>
> --
> Around ten thousand functions in one REALbasic plug-in. The MBS
> Plugin.
> <http://www.monkeybreadsoftware.de/realbasic/plugins.shtml>

Re: thread legt interace lahm
Date: 08.08.05 12:23 (Mon, 8 Aug 2005 13:23:28 +0200)
From: Yves Seiler
ok, verstanden.
das heisst ich müsste in einer batchanwendung zuerst alle bilder
laden und erst dann den thread arbeiten lassen, oder?

gruss
yves


On Aug 8, 2005, at 1:13 PM, Christian Schmitz wrote:

> Yves Seiler <<email address removed>> wrote:
>
>> hi christian
>> das wusste ich nicht, du meinst also, die funktionen extern in einer
>> methode anlegen und dann via thread aufrufen?
>> werde ich mal versuchen:)
>>
> Es geht darum, dass ein Threadwechsel nur bei einer Schleife passieren
> kann. Ohne Schleife kein Threading in RB.
>
> Folglich wird bei einem folderitem.OpenAsPicture das Programm stehen,
> bis das Bild fertig geladen ist.
>
> Mfg
> Christian
>
> --
> Around ten thousand functions in one REALbasic plug-in. The MBS
> Plugin.
> <http://www.monkeybreadsoftware.de/realbasic/plugins.shtml>

Re: thread legt interace lahm
Date: 08.08.05 12:30 (Mon, 08 Aug 2005 13:30:04 +0200)
From: Andy Fuchs
Nein... du müsstest die Bilder zeilenweise einlesen (geht im Thread), danach
zusammenbauen (geht auch im Thread), skalieren (geht auch im Thread) und
dann zeilenweise speichern (geht auch im Thread).

Wenn Du alle bilder im Batch lädtst, dann gewinnst du nix...

--